Position Summary

The Reliability Engineer is responsible for improving the reliability and performance of manufacturing equipment and systems within a dairy production facility. This role focuses on reducing downtime, optimizing preventive and predictive maintenance programs, analyzing equipment failures, and leading root cause analysis and continuous improvement initiatives to maximize plant uptime and efficiency.

Key Responsibilities

Equipment Reliability



  • Develop and implement asset reliability strategies for critical dairy processing and packaging equipment (e.g., pasteurizers, separators, fillers, CIP systems).
  • Analyze failure modes and recommend design or process improvements to prevent recurrence.
  • Drive asset lifecycle management through effective maintenance, repair, and replacement plans.


Maintenance Optimization



  • Partner with Maintenance and Production teams to enhance preventative maintenance schedules and implement predictive maintenance technologies (e.g., vibration analysis, thermal imaging, oil analysis).
  • Utilize CMMS (Computerized Maintenance Management System) data to track equipment performance and identify areas for improvement.
  • Review and improve spare parts inventory levels based on criticality and usage trends.


Root Cause Analysis & Problem Solving



  • Lead Root Cause Failure Analysis (RCFA) and Failure Modes and Effects Analysis (FMEA) for chronic issues and significant downtime events.
  • Collaborate cross-functionally to implement long-term corrective actions and monitor results.
  • Support Teir II troubleshooting and recovery from downtime events


Project Engineering Support



  • Provide technical expertise for reliability-related capital projects and equipment upgrades.
  • Participate in commissioning of new equipment to ensure proper reliability and maintainability standards are met.


Training & Technical Support



  • Educate and mentor maintenance technicians on reliability best practices and failure prevention methods.
  • Support operator training related to basic equipment care and early problem detection.
  • Develop and support technical training

For five generations spanning over a century, Daisy Brand has been a family-owned company committed to providing the freshest, most wholesome dairy products. The company is headquartered in Dallas, Texas with manufacturing facilities in Garland, Texas (1998), Casa Grande, Arizona (2008), and Wooster, Ohio (2015).



Daisy is the market leader in two billion-dollar categories, sour cream and cottage cheese, and generates over half a billion in revenues annually. Daisy Sour Cream represents 1 out of every 2 sour cream purchases in the United States and is the largest sour cream brand in food service, military, and club. It is recognized by consumers for A Dollop of Daisy, a tagline that put this once small brand on the map. Daisy Cottage Cheese is America's #1 cottage cheese brand and continues to bring new consumers into the category with its innovative single serve packaging and consistent high quality. Daisy recently expanded into a new category with the launch of two dip products and is in the process of expanding distribution.


Daisy's core values, Clean and Trust, resonate in all aspects of our business operations. In 2008, the Foundation for Financial Service Professionals awarded Daisy the prestigious American Business Ethics award.
